In a surprising turn of events, Konstantin Bogomolov has requested to be relieved of his duties as the acting rector of the renowned MKhAT School-Studio. This decision has sent ripples through the theater community, raising questions about the future direction of one of Russia’s most prestigious institutions. His resignation not only marks a personal transition but also signifies a critical juncture for MKhAT, which has been a cornerstone of Russian theatrical tradition since its founding in 1898.
